Le Palais des Papes

Once the residence of the sovereign pontiffs of the 14th century and a UNESCO World Heritage site, the Palais des Papes in Avignon is the largest Gothic palace in the world.

Rhonéa à Beaumes-de-Venise

Around the village and into the heart of the Dentelles de Montmirail, you’ll find “Les Balmes,” natural caves carved into the safre stone. These geological formations, combined with the area’s ties to the Comtat Venaissin, gave the village its name: Balma Venitia… Beaumes-de-Venise.
